Abstract

In order to improve the computing efficiency of user important data security and virtual machine disk integrity verification in cloud computing model, a secure dynamic update storage strategy based on electronic stream cipher in cloud computing is proposed. Firstly, the cloud service provider introduces the concept of virtualization to maintain the virtualization server, storage, and so on to realize the real-time security migration of the virtual machine. At the same time, a model based on the secure electronic stream cipher is introduced. The encryption/decryption uses the ChaCha20 method to maintain the appropriate security for the user sensitive data in the cloud data, to realize data virtualization and dynamic updating in virtual machine disk. Secondly, a new dynamic version of the Merkle B+Hash tree (DMBHT) is proposed. This method does not require random Oracle signature scheme, while uses q-strong Diffie-Hellman (q-SDH) secure short signature, and uses effective bit rate as pseudo delete code (Tornado-z code) on the leaf level of DBHT, which can effectively keep the integrity and authenticity between the virtual machine disk. Finally, simulation results show that the proposed algorithm can achieve fast update and secure modification, and the effectiveness of the proposed algorithm is verified.
